A truly iconic Morris & Co. design, Strawberry Thief combines its designer’s fascination for the dramas of nature with a love of rich, complex pattern. Originally created by William Morris in 1883, the much-loved Strawberry Thief is inspired by thrushes pinching strawberries from his kitchen garden at Kelmscott House.
